Which to use
“jedes” is a pronoun and “jeher” is an adverb - they look or sound alike but fill different roles in a sentence.

| Feature | jedes | jeher |
|---|---|---|
| Definition | alle Einzelnen einer Gruppe | so lange, wie die Erinnerung zurückreicht |
